What invasive species threaten Venice Gardens landscapes, and how do I control them safely?

Brazilian pepper and cogongrass pose significant invasion risks in Zone 10a. Manual removal followed by targeted herbicide application during permitted months avoids fertilizer ordinance violations. Treatment outside the nitrogen blackout period from June 1 to September 30 prevents nutrient runoff issues. Regular monitoring prevents re-establishment while protecting native plant communities.

What's the best solution for seasonal flooding in my Venice Gardens yard?

High water tables and seasonal flooding are common with Sandy Fine Sand soils that have limited percolation capacity. Installing French drains connected to swales redirects surface water effectively. Using permeable Travertine pavers for hardscapes reduces runoff volume while meeting Sarasota County Planning and Development Services standards. This approach manages stormwater without requiring extensive grading permits.

How do I keep St. Augustine grass healthy with only two watering days per week?

Stage 1 water restrictions permit irrigation twice weekly, which challenges Floratam St. Augustine's moisture needs. Smart Wi-Fi controllers with soil moisture sensors optimize timing by tracking evapotranspiration rates and soil conditions. These systems apply water only when turfgrass stress thresholds are reached, maximizing efficiency. Proper calibration prevents overwatering while maintaining turf health within municipal limits.
